Wide-ranging tabletop role-playing discussion, a variety of guests, and occasional actual-play content. All done with a casual, conversational vibe. Everything from tips for playing and GMing, to rule system discussions, with plenty of whatever happens to cross our minds along the way! Are we ”experts”? No! Do we really love ttRPGs? HECK YEAH!!! In this episode, Kate explores the Wesleyan Quadrilateral as a valuable framework for reading and interpreting scripture. This approach offers a more balanced and holistic way to engage with the Bible, especially for those who are deconstructing or reconstructing their faith.
